| Battles With Dual Names. |
|
There is a difference of opinion when it comes to naming some of the battles, even today. The Northern forces often named battles after rivers or creeks, while Southern forces often named them after nearby towns. In fact, the Civil War itself was known by multitude of different names. A few of the dual-named battles are listed here along with some of the alternate names for the war.
|
| Northern Name | Southern Name | Bull Run | Manassas | Wilson's Creek | Oak Hills | Ball's Bluff | Leesburg | Logan's Cross Roads | Mill Springs | Pea Ridge | Elkhorn Tavern | Pittsburg Landing | Shiloh | Seven Pines | Fair Oaks | Chickahominy River | Gaine's Mill | Chantilly | Ox Hill | South Mountain | Boonsboro | Antietam | Sharpsburg | Chaplin Hills | Perryville | Stones River | Murfreesboro | Sabine Cross Roads | Mansfield | Opequon | Winchester | | |
| The Civil War |
War Between the States |
War of the Rebellion |
War of Southern Independence |
War of Northern Agression |
War for States' Rights |
Mr. Lincoln's War |
War of Secession |
War for Abolition |
Second American Revolution |
Southern Rebellion |
War to Suppress Yankee Arrogance |
The Brother's War |
The Great Rebellion |
War for Nationality |
War of the Sixties |
